To measure Protein Lowry standards and samples
Before you begin...
Before taking pedestal measurements with the NanoDrop One instrument, lift the instrument
arm and clean the upper and lower pedestals. At a minimum, wipe the pedestals with a new
laboratory wipe. For more information, see Cleaning the Pedestals.
NOTICE
• Do not use a squirt or spray bottle on or near the instrument as liquids will flow into
the instrument and may cause permanent damage.
• Do not use hydrofluoric acid (HF) on the pedestals. Fluoride ions will permanently
damage the quartz fiber optic cables.
To measure Protein Lowry standards and samples
1. From the Home screen, select the Proteins tab and tap Protein Lowry.
2. Specify a curve type and number of replicates for each standard and enter the
concentration of each standard.
Tip: For this assay, we recommend setting Curve Type to “2nd Order Polynomial.”
3. Measure blank:
